Frequently Asked Sales Engineer Interview Questions
Create a comprehensive evidence plan for selling into a highly regulated industry (e.g., healthcare). The plan must include: types of artifacts (legal, technical, operational), timeline to produce or obtain them, required internal approvals, and one contingency if a key artifact (e.g., an audited SOC report) is unavailable.
Sample Answer
Overview (role perspective)
As a Sales Engineer, I’d deliver an evidence plan that maps artifacts to buyer concerns (legal/regulatory, technical security, operational processes), a production timeline aligned to sales stages, required internal approvers, and a fallback if an audited SOC isn’t available.
Artifacts — by category
- Legal: Data processing addendum (DPA), standard contractual clauses, HIPAA Business Associate Agreement (BAA) template, SLAs.
- Technical: Architecture diagrams, network/data flow, encryption-at-rest/in-transit specs, pen-test/ vuln scan reports, system hardening checklist, access controls, IAM policies.
- Operational: Incident response plan, runbooks, backup/retention policies, change control logs, employee background-check policy, staffing/org chart, audit trails/monitoring dashboards.
- Certifications/audits: SOC 2 Type II, ISO 27001 certificate, penetration test attestation, privacy impact assessment.
Timeline (aligned to sales stages)
- Week 0–2 (Qualification): high-level architecture, BAA template, SLAs, compliance summary.
- Week 2–6 (Technical validation / PoC): detailed diagrams, pen-test summary, runbooks, demo tenancy with logging.
- Week 6–12 (Legal review & procurement): DPA/BAA final, SOC/ISO packages, background-check attestation, incident response evidence.
- Ongoing: quarterly vulnerability scans, annual audits.
Internal approvals
- Legal: DPA/BAA and contract clauses.
- Security/Infosec: pen-test, SOC/ISO package validation, encryption claims.
- Privacy/Data Protection Officer: data residency & DPIA.
- Ops/Engineering: runbooks, backup/restore proofs, SLA feasibility.
- Sales Leadership: commercial concessions tied to evidence delivery timeline.
Contingency — no audited SOC report
- Provide a compensating controls package: recent internal audit report, external pen-test with remediation evidence, continuous monitoring screenshots, architecture that minimizes customer scoped risk (e.g., customer-dedicated encryption keys / BYOK), a written remediation roadmap with committed timeline to obtain SOC plus an escrow or indemnity clause negotiated by Legal.
- Offer a limited-scope pilot with contractual risk limits and more frequent security reviews during pilot.
This plan ensures buyers’ regulatory needs are met while keeping the sales cycle moving; I’d maintain a checklist in CRM and a gated artifact playbook to track approvals and delivery.
How do you distinguish between a true product limitation and an implementation risk or customer-side configuration issue when a buyer raises a technical concern? Provide two example objections that look similar but require different responses, and show the language you would use to reframe each.
Sample Answer
Approach (how I diagnose)
- Ask clarifying, data-driven questions: environment, versions, logs, repro steps, timeline.
- Triangulate: demo a minimal repro, consult runbook/known-issues, replicate in our staging.
- Classify: evidence of product behavior (repeatable across environments) → product limitation; failure only in one customer setup or integration step → implementation risk or configuration issue.
Example 1 — Looks like a product limitation
Objection: "Your API can't scale to 10k concurrent connections — it's unusable for us."
Reframe language I’d use: "Help me understand how you measured concurrency. Can you share the test script, client environment, and API version? If we can reproduce it in our staging with the same load, we'll treat it as a product limitation; if not, we'll identify tunables or client-side bottlenecks."
Example 2 — Looks similar but is implementation/config
Objection: "The service times out under load; your product isn't reliable."
Reframe language I’d use: "Thanks — can you confirm timeout settings, network proxies, and load-balancer health checks? Often timeouts trace back to client-side retries or proxy limits. Let's run a controlled test from your environment and from our cloud to pinpoint where latency spikes."
Why this works
- Moves conversation from accusation to evidence gathering
- Sets a clear next step (reproduce/test)
- Keeps trust: commits to investigate while framing likely causes and remediation paths

Given these market segments and attributes, propose a simple scoring model and rank the top 3 segments to prioritize for outbound sales:
Segments:
- Enterprise Finance: TAM $120M, avg ACV $150k, sales cycle 9 months, strategic-fit high
- Mid-market Retail: TAM $80M, avg ACV $50k, sales cycle 4 months, fit medium
- Healthcare Providers: TAM $60M, avg ACV $120k, sales cycle 10 months, fit high
- Technology Startups: TAM $40M, avg ACV $30k, sales cycle 3 months, fit low
Describe your weighting logic and show final ranked list.
Sample Answer
Approach & assumptions
As a Sales Engineer I want a pragmatic scoring model balancing value, ease, and strategic fit so outbound SDR/AE+SE time targets highest return. I normalize each attribute to a 0–1 scale and weight by business impact.
Scoring formula
Score = 0.40 * (Normalized ACV) + 0.30 * (Normalized TAM) + 0.20 * (Normalized Fit) + 0.10 * (Normalized Sales Speed)
- Higher ACV and TAM increase revenue potential.
- Fit reflects ease of technical alignment (high/med/low -> 1/0.66/0.33).
- Sales Speed uses inverse of sales cycle so shorter cycles score higher.
Normalized inputs (0–1)
- ACV: max 150k -> Enterprise 1.00, Healthcare 0.80, Mid-market 0.33, Startups 0.20
- TAM: max 120M -> Enterprise 1.00, Mid 0.67, Healthcare 0.50, Startups 0.33
- Fit: Enterprise 1.00, Healthcare 1.00, Mid 0.66, Startups 0.33
- Sales Speed (inverse cycle normalized to max): cycle min=3 -> Startups 1.00, Mid 0.75, Enterprise 0.33, Healthcare 0.30
Calculated scores
- Enterprise Finance: 0.401.00 + 0.301.00 + 0.201.00 + 0.100.33 = 0.933
- Healthcare Providers: 0.400.80 + 0.300.50 + 0.201.00 + 0.100.30 = 0.646
- Mid-market Retail: 0.400.33 + 0.300.67 + 0.200.66 + 0.100.75 = 0.509
- Technology Startups: 0.400.20 + 0.300.33 + 0.200.33 + 0.101.00 = 0.319
Top 3 priority for outbound
- Enterprise Finance
- Healthcare Providers
- Mid-market Retail
Recommendation: assign Senior SE + AE for Enterprise, targeted technical playbooks for Healthcare, and scaled SDR outreach + templated demos for Mid-market.
Create a playbook for preparing demo environments and runbooks for on-premise prospects versus cloud prospects. Address setup steps, firewall and network requirements, expected lead time, demo-data handling, security checklist, and what pre-demo documentation you would require from the customer to avoid delays.
Sample Answer
Overview / Objective
A repeatable playbook to prepare demo environments and runbooks for on‑premise vs cloud prospects so demos are reliable, secure, and delivered on schedule.
Clarify requirements up front
- Ask customer for: environment type (on‑prem / cloud), network diagram, IP allowlist, authentication method (SAML/LDAP), expected data volume, PCI/PII constraints, maintenance windows, contact + escalation list, timeline for approvals.
Lead time
- Cloud (SaaS/PaaS): 3–5 business days (account provisioning, test data)
- On‑prem: 3–6 weeks (access approvals, firewall/VPN, install, verification)
- Callout: regulated orgs may add 2–4 weeks for security review
Setup steps
Cloud
- Provision tenant/subscription and demo instance
- Configure network access (IP allowlist / CIDR)
- Integrate auth (prov. SAML test app)
- Load anonymized demo data and baseline dashboards
- Run smoke tests and create snapshot image
On‑prem
- Confirm hardware/VM specs and OS versions
- Provide installer or container image + prerequisites
- Establish secure connectivity (VPN / jump box) and service account
- Install, configure, integrate with LDAP/AD if required
- Execute validation scripts and collect logs
Firewall & network
- Required ports, protocols, and destination IPs (provide exact list)
- VPN/IPSec or SSH bastion for on‑prem access
- MTU, proxy, and outbound HTTPS allowlist for cloud callbacks
- RTT/bandwidth minimums for acceptable demo UX
Demo-data handling
- Use synthetic or anonymized subset; never use raw PII
- Provide data generation scripts and data mapping doc
- Retain ephemeral demo datasets; automated purge after session
Security checklist
- Least privilege service accounts and key rotation
- TLS enforced, cert validation
- SSO integration with test account
- Logging enabled, retention policy for demo artifacts
- Signed NDA and Acceptable Use confirmed
- Vulnerability scan for on‑prem install (optional per customer policy)
Runbook (pre-demo & run)
- Pre-demo checklist: access verification, credentials, smoke tests, failover steps
- Live-run script: demo flow, timed checkpoints, data refresh steps, rollback
- Troubleshooting: common errors, logs paths, escalation matrix
Pre-demo documentation to request
- Network diagram, firewall change approval template, admin contact, sample data schema, auth provider details, maintenance window calendar, compliance constraints, POA for on‑prem installers.
Result: standardized, low‑risk demos with predictable timelines and clear security posture that reduces last‑minute delays and increases conversion rates.
Design a deal structure for a strategic customer that includes performance SLAs, ramped pricing (discount during onboarding, price increases after adoption milestones), and penalty/credit clauses. Model the financial impact on revenue and margin over 4 years under three adoption scenarios: slow, base, and fast. Explain how you'd present trade-offs to legal and engineering stakeholders.
Sample Answer
Deal structure (overview)
- Term: 4 years, commitment by seat or consumption baseline.
- Pricing: onboarding discount Year 1, staged step-ups tied to adoption milestones (70% baseline -> 85% -> 100% list).
- SLAs: availability 99.9% core, 99.5% non-core; performance P95 latency targets; onboarding timeline milestones.
- Penalties/credits: service credits for SLA breaches (per-incident cap or % of monthly invoice), accelerated remediation SOW at supplier at-cost if repeated breaches.
Concrete pricing model (example)
- List price annual revenue per customer = $1,000,000.
- Onboarding discount Y1 = 40% (customer pays $600k). Ramp: Y2 15% off ($850k), Y3 5% off ($950k), Y4 full ($1,000k).
- Penalty credit: 5% of monthly invoice per major SLA breach, capped 20% annually.
Adoption scenarios (annual % of list realizing revenue)
- Slow: 40%, 60%, 80%, 90% → Revenues: 400k, 600k, 800k, 900k = $2.7M total.
- Base: 60%, 80%, 95%, 100% → 600k, 800k, 950k, 1,000k = $3.35M.
- Fast: 80%, 95%, 100%, 100% → 800k, 950k, 1,000k, 1,000k = $3.75M.
Margin & penalties
- Gross margin assumptions: 70% normal; onboarding support increases cost +10 p.p. in Y1.
- Apply potential SLA credits: assume 0.5% annual in Base, 2% in Slow (more issues), 0.2% in Fast. Adjusted margins computed per-year.
How I’d model
- Build spreadsheet with rows: list price, discount, realized % adoption, revenue, COGS (fixed + variable), SLA credits, gross margin. Scenario tabs for sensitivities; include IRR and payback timing.
Presenting trade-offs
- To Legal: focus on clear, measurable SLA language, caps, dispute resolution, and how credits limit downside; propose standardized clause templates and escalation timelines.
- To Engineering: show adoption curve sensitivity, onboarding resource load, required SLOs and runbook expectations; present peak support weeks and engineering effort forecast so they can commit to delivery SLAs or negotiate extended ramp.
I’d bring the spreadsheet to stakeholder reviews, highlight breakpoints (where credits hit caps or margin turns negative), and recommend mitigations: reduce onboarding discount, increase milestone gates, or add professional services fees.
Design a clear handoff process from pre-sales (POC complete) to the post-sales implementation team. Define the required artifacts (configs, runbooks, test results), acceptance criteria for the handoff, the knowledge-transfer session structure, and how you'd measure handoff success and reduce rework.
Sample Answer
Clarify scope & stakeholders
- Pre-sales (SE, Account Exec, POC engineer), Post-sales (Implementation PM, Solution Architect, Support), Customer technical owner.
- Handoff triggered when POC acceptance criteria met and signed POC summary delivered.
Required artifacts
- POC Summary: objectives, scope, success criteria met, outstanding risks.
- Configuration export: templates, parameter values, network diagrams, account IDs, API keys (redacted), versioning.
- Runbooks: deployment steps, rollback procedures, maintenance tasks, escalation matrix.
- Test results: test plan, automated/manual test logs, performance benchmarks.
- Open issues & backlog: JIRA/Ticket links, priority, owner.
Acceptance criteria
- All artifacts uploaded to shared repo and referenced in CRM.
- Customer sign-off on POC summary and itemized config.
- No critical/blocker issues; medium issues must have mitigation plan.
- Implementation PM acknowledges resource and timeline availability.
Knowledge-transfer session structure
- Kickoff (15m): attendees, objectives, timeline.
- Walkthrough (45m): config, architecture, test results, known issues.
- Live demo (30m): deploy/recover critical path.
- Q&A & exercises (30m): customer/PM run a task, confirm competency.
- Recording + Q&A doc, action items with owners.
Measure success & reduce rework
- Metrics: time-to-first-successful-deploy, number of handback tickets within 30 days, customer satisfaction (NPS), percentage of docs passed checklist.
- Reduce rework by checklist gating in CRM, mandatory artefact templates, 2-week follow-up review, and automated validation scripts to verify config consistency before handoff.
This process ensures traceability, shared responsibility, and minimizes implementation surprises.
A CTO says their company is locked into a competitor contract for 2 years and claims they can't switch. As the Sales Engineer, how would you probe to understand the contractual constraints, present migration/ coexistence strategies that enable early wins, and propose a phased adoption plan while respecting the incumbent agreement?
Sample Answer
Situation & goal
I’m the Sales Engineer helping a CTO who says they’re contractually locked for 2 years. My goal: surface the actual constraints, find compliant ways to deliver value today, and propose a phased migration that minimizes risk and respects the incumbent agreement.
Probing questions (what I’d ask)
- Who signed the contract and what type is it (term license, enterprise agreement, exclusive vendor clause)?
- Which clauses matter: exclusivity, minimum spend, termination penalties, IP/data transfer, SLA or certification requirements?
- Are there opt‑outs, change-of-control, pilot, or evaluation exceptions?
- What systems/data/services are tied to the incumbent vs. configurable or modular components?
- Who are legal, procurement, and technical stakeholders and their priorities?
Migration & coexistence strategies
- Side‑by‑side coexistence: integrate via APIs/ETL to demonstrate improvements without ripping out incumbent.
- Dual‑write or proxy approach: route a subset of traffic to our product for A/B tests.
- Data sync & outbound adapters: replicate non‑sensitive data to our environment for reporting or ML.
- Managed pilot: limited scope (team/region/feature) minimizing contractual exposure.
Phased adoption plan
- Legal/Procurement review — map clauses and approve pilot scope.
- Proof-of-value pilot (4–8 weeks) — target low-risk module, measurable KPIs.
- Expand to hybrid mode — integrate more workloads, automation of sync.
- Full migration readiness — finalize data migration, cutover plan, rollback.
- Commercial transition — negotiate offsets/credits aligning with renewal or opt-out windows.
Example
At a previous deal the customer had a 12‑month MS enterprise commitment. We ran a 6‑week pilot using API integration for one business unit, reduced processing latency by 40%, then expanded under a hybrid model timed with their renewal, avoiding penalties.
Why this works: it respects contract terms, builds trust with measurable wins, involves legal early, and aligns technical rollout with commercial levers.
During discovery you learn the prospect is under contract with a competitor that expires in 7 months. What specific questions and next steps would you use to determine the window of opportunity, potential break clauses, and the best way to position an early migration or pilot?
Sample Answer
Situation & goal
I want to uncover the exact timing, legal flexibility, technical blockers, and business drivers so we can either schedule a smooth migration post-expiry or create a legitimate early-exit pilot/POC that reduces risk and accelerates conversion.
Key discovery questions
- Contract & legal:
- Who signed the contract and where is the contract stored? Can you share the relevant SLA/termination clauses?
- Is there an auto-renewal, notice period, or penalty for early termination?
- Any exclusivity, minimum commitment, or non-compete clauses?
- Break / flexibility:
- Have you or any team ever negotiated amendments with the incumbent? Under what grounds?
- Are there service failures, missed SLAs, or upcoming audits that could justify an early exit?
- Timing & decision drivers:
- What business events align with the 7‑month expiry (budget cycle, renewals, product launches)?
- Who are the procurement, legal, and technical stakeholders and their approval timelines?
- Technical & risk:
- Which integrations/data flows would be most risky to migrate? What success metrics matter?
- Can we run a pilot in parallel without touching production?
Next steps / positioning
- Request a copy or summary of termination/renewal clauses and identify notice deadlines.
- Map stakeholder timeline in CRM and propose milestone calendar aligned to budget windows.
- Propose a low-risk pilot: demo environment + limited-scope POC that proves value (3–8 weeks), with defined success metrics (latency, cost, error rate).
- Offer an early-value “gap” project (integration, automation) that coexists with incumbent and builds internal advocates.
- Partner with legal to draft a non-disruptive statement of work and with sales to propose a pricing credit if early migration occurs.
- Prepare a migration plan showing rollback, timelines, and clear ROI to share in an exec briefing.
Why this works
It uncovers legal levers, aligns to business cadence, minimizes perceived risk via parallel pilots, and builds internal momentum so the renewal window becomes an opportunity rather than a roadblock.
Define 'learning agility' and 'growth mindset' and explain how each specifically applies to the Sales Engineer role. Provide concrete, role-specific examples of behaviors or practices (for example: iterating on prototype demos, proactively reading product release notes, shadowing product/engineering, or cross-training across modules) that demonstrate each concept in day-to-day sales-engineering work.
Sample Answer
Definition — Learning Agility
Learning agility is the ability to quickly understand new information, apply it in novel situations, and adapt behavior based on feedback. For a Sales Engineer this means rapidly mastering new product features, customer environments, or competitor moves and applying that knowledge to tailor technical conversations and demos.
Concrete behaviors:
- Iterating prototype demos after each customer pilot to incorporate feedback.
- Rapidly reading release notes and updating demo scripts same day.
- Shadowing engineering to understand internal constraints and surface realistic solutions.
Definition — Growth Mindset
Growth mindset is believing abilities can improve through effort and learning. In sales engineering it shows as persistence, seeking challenges, and treating setbacks (lost deals, failed demos) as learning opportunities.
Concrete behaviors:
- Asking for post-loss technical debriefs and integrating lessons into playbooks.
- Cross-training across product modules to broaden solutioning options.
- Routinely practicing tough Q&A with peers and recording sessions to improve responses.
Both traits drive faster ramp, better customer trust, and higher win rates.
